Common use of Order Book Reconciliation Report Clause in Contracts

Order Book Reconciliation Report. On a monthly basis, the Authority shall provide the Contractor with an Order Book Reconciliation Report. The report shall detail all orders that are considered open, confirming order number, Contract Deliverables ordered, quantities and Confirmed Delivery Date. The Contractor shall respond within 5 business days of the date of issue of the report to confirm any anomalies in the orders listed, any orders considered open but not listed, details of orders that have since been dispatched, and, for those orders that remain outstanding, confirmation that the Confirmed Delivery Date shall be achieved.
